Recent Activities and Events

As of 2023, Jesse Jackson has been vocal regarding various socio-political issues, including voting rights, healthcare equity, and racial injustice. His organization, Rainbow PUSH Coalition, has been at the forefront of advocating for these essential civil rights. In July 2023, Jackson participated in a series of marches advocating for fair voting practices, emphasizing the importance of safeguarding democracy in America. He has also addressed issues surrounding police reform and the criminal justice system, remaining steadfast in his commitment to civil rights.

Jackson’s ability to galvanize communities has been critical during pivotal moments in recent history. His presence during protests, particularly those concerning police brutality, shows his dedication to the cause and reinforces the belief in collective action for change. His advocacy has inspired a new generation of activists who are rallying for social justice, reflecting his long-standing position as a leader in this field.

Impact on Society

The impact of Jesse Jackson’s work cannot be understated. His journey from being a protégé of Martin Luther King Jr. to becoming a prominent leader himself has symbolized the ongoing struggle for civil rights. Jackson’s efforts have not only led to critical changes in policy but have also raised awareness about the systemic inequalities faced by many. His emphasis on economic empowerment has prompted discussions around the importance of financial equity in creating a more just society.
